Feature: Online Rental
The Storage Mall – Palmyra
Self-Storage Units in Palmyra, NY About The Storage Mall – Palmyra, NY Are you looking for Drive-Up, Self Storage Units in the Palmyra area of New York? Searching google for terms like “self storage near me” but just can’t seem to find a location that has the amenities that you are looking for? Look no…
The Storage Mall – Niagara Falls
Self Storage Units in Niagara Falls, NY. – The Storage Mall About The Storage Mall – Niagara Falls, NY Are you looking for Vehicle Parking, Drive-Up, Climate Controlled, or Temperature Controlled Self Storage Units in the Niagara Falls area of New York? Searching google for terms like “climate control storage near me” but just can’t…
The Storage Mall – Townsend
Self Storage Units In Townsend, DE About The Storage Mall – Townsend, DE Are you looking for Vehicle Parking or Drive-Up Self Storage Units in the Townsend area of Delaware? Searching google for terms like “self storage near me” but just can’t seem to find a location that has the amenities that you are looking for?…
The Storage Mall – Tom’s River Flint Rd.
About The Storage Mall – South Toms River Self Storage Are you looking for Vehicle Parking or Drive-Up Self Storage Units in the Toms River area of New Jersey? Searching google for terms like “self storage near me” but just can’t seem to find a location that has the amenities that you are looking for?…